A kind of hollow glass lattice material aluminium extruded sections of built-in framework
Technical field
It is a kind of aluminium alloy door window profile that the utility model relates to, particularly a kind of hollow glass lattice material aluminium extruded sections of built-in framework.
Background technology
Alumium alloy door and window have good looking appearance, good airproof performance, lightweight and be convenient to the plurality of advantages such as prefabricated, and it has been widely used in various building.Mounting glass window on aluminium alloys fixed frame, is fixed on the monolithic glass structure in door and window framework, and the area surrounded due to door and window framework is large, and therefore rated wind velocity is not high, and security performance is low.
Therefore, for avoiding above-mentioned technical problem, the necessary hollow glass lattice material aluminium extruded sections providing a kind of built-in framework, to overcome described defect of the prior art.
Utility model content
The purpose of this utility model is to overcome the deficiencies in the prior art, provides a kind of hollow glass lattice material aluminium extruded sections of built-in framework, and this profile structure strengthens door and window framework intensity, improves door and window framework wind loading rating.
